Frequently Asked Questions about Galveston

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Galveston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Galveston ranges from $850 to $2,400 with an average monthly rent of $1,148.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Galveston c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Galveston range from $1,020 to $4,050.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,558.

How expensive are Galveston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 49 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Galveston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,260 to $5,515 - averaging $2,299 for the location.
